It's spring time. We're all getting our power equipment out of storage and starting them up. If you have something that doesn't fire right up, put some Seafoam in the gas tank. Give it a few pulls and walk away. Every hour or two go back and give it another short try. When it's ready it will fire up. The only time this hasn't worked is when I bought a Honda Rototiller and the Carb hadn't been drained for 2 - 3 years and the float was bad. And very importantly .. every fall .. put Seafoam in EVERY gas tank you have and run the engine till the treatment run's all the way through. Next spring your equipment will fire right up.
